Factors Affecting Cost
- Extent of Damage: The severity of the damage will significantly impact the repair cost. Minor cracks are less expensive to fix than major structural issues.
- Materials Used: The type of materials required for the repair, such as concrete or specialized sealants, can influence the total expense.
- Labor Costs: Labor rates in College Station can vary, affecting the overall cost based on the complexity of the job.
- Permits and Inspections: Some repairs may require permits or inspections, adding to the overall cost.
- Accessibility: If the sidewalk is difficult to access, additional equipment or labor may be needed, increasing the cost.
- Weather Conditions: Seasonal weather patterns in College Station can impact the timing and cost of repairs.
Common Tasks and Costs
Task | Average Cost (College Station, TX) |
---|---|
Minor Crack Repair | $100 - $300 |
Major Crack Filling | $300 - $600 |
Concrete Slab Replacement | $500 - $1,200 per slab |
Tree Root Removal and Repair | $200 - $800 |
Leveling Uneven Sections | $300 - $700 |
Sealant Application | $100 - $400 |
